THESIS.
The capacity and aptitude for motion, observable in man, naturally lead us to an enquiry into the general principle of his corporeal functions. To a disquisition of which I devote the following pages.
Aware of the intricacy of my subject, and that the operations of the animal body necessarily embrace agents not within the range of our senses, I cannot indulge in the hope that I shall be altogether successful in an examination of the laws of its economy. Where so many enlightened and able intellects have labored in vain, it would require an excess of vanity in me to expect to succeed; and, I trust, should I leave some of the difficulties unsurmounted and inequalities unsmoothed, I shall not be fairly chargeable with temerity or indiscretion.
Amidst our contemplation of the various simple and compound actions, of which the human body is capable, and in which it is perpetually engaged, we are unavoidably led to ask――whence is the peculiar power or capacity, so admirably diffused throughout its numerous parts, by which those actions are performed? Is it by any peculiarity of organization? or by properties different according to the nature of the various constituent parts? or a particular principle, not strictly inherent in any one part, but diffused to all? It cannot be in the organization, although it does not manifest itself without organization, for, if so, there would uniformly be a difference between the texture of dead and living parts, which frequently is not the fact. Nor have we full and satisfactory evidence on which to found the opinion that it is owing to properties differing in their essential natures according to the parts concerned. That the principle of life or capacity of acting, or being acted on, is strictly the property of one part, and is by diffusion communicated to the rest, we have much reason to conclude from the phenomena of both health and disease.

Some physiologists, and those of no mean note, have considered the operations of the human frame as a circle of functions governed by mechanical organic laws, as we discover in an hydraulic machine, or automaton, so admirably formed, as by the mere force of its construction to perform and continue the vital motions.
In confutation of such an opinion we have nothing to do more than to introduce the words of the justly celebrated Doct. Whytt. “It seems” (says that writer) “to be incumbent on those philosophers who ascribe the motion of the heart to mechanical causes alone, to demonstrate the possibility of a perpetuum mobile, since as long as life lasts, an animal appears to be really such.” And it needs scarcely be added that perpetual motion is demonstrably without the laws of mechanics, and far above the power of mechanism. These considerations are, I judge, sufficient to put to rest all idea of an independent organic life: If others are wanted, it may be shewn that life, sense, and self-action, are inconsistent with the general properties of matter.
